Rudy And The Rentboys

Rudy And The Rentboys are a talented four piece band consisting of guitar, keys, bass and drums boast a wealth of musical experience having played at the Royal Albert Hall and recorded with the Who’s Pete Townshend in his private home studio.

Their three part harmonies soar above the tight and punchy music and the tunes will ensure their energetic show keeps the dance floor full! They fill the stage and infect the room with a powerful, pulsating performance that are bound to leave any crowd, be it old or young, begging for encore after encore.
